		<description>Correction to the story. Rather more of a clarification. in 2000 it was Travelocity&#039;s parent Sabre who purchased the recently renamed Getthere and merged it with their Sabre BTS subsidiary. Getthere&#039;s original name was ITN - for Internet Travel Network. Sabre paid a cool $757 Million for the business at the time. Thanks to SC for the corrections. Cheers. TOD.</description>
